The Research Bottleneck Is Real, Here’s How to Fix It
The research bottleneck occurs when insights do not keep up with decision-making, leading to delays for consultants, investors, and corporations. Traditional workflows, static reports, slow expert calls, and limited analyst capacity contribute to these costly delays. The solution is to redesign the process by automating low-value tasks, sourcing experts more quickly, focusing on decision-ready intelligence, and incorporating real-time perspectives. When done correctly, research can become a catalyst for sharper, faster, and more confident decision-making.
